Edouard Juvet, Fleurier, No. 46343, Swiss, made for the Chinese Market, circa 1870. Very fine 18K gold and enamel centre-seconds watch, with special escapement. Double body, the fixed bezel, pendant and bow, with champleve enamelled decoration, the back enamel panel with a fine painted scene depicting a nobleman helping his loved one to cross the stream. Hinged polished-gold cuvette with bright cut and engraved decoration. White enamel with Roman numerals and outer minutes and seconds ring. Gold "spade" hands. Gilt-brass, fully engraved, Chinese caliber with free standing barrel, single wheel duplex escapement, five-arm polished-steel balance, ruby end-stone, flat balance spring with regulator. Signed oil the movement. Diam. 57 mm.
